Tomizuka, Masayoshi. "On the Design of Digital Tracking Controllers." Journal of Dynamic Systems, Measurement, and Control 115, no. 2B (1993): 412–18. http://dx.doi.org/10.1115/1.2899081.

Full text
Abstract:
This paper describes my work on the design of digital tracking controllers over the past two decades. In tracking control, the control object must be moved along a time varying desired output and the transient path error must be minimized. Tracking control is discussed for the following two typical situations: one is the situation where the desired output is known in advance and the other is where the desired output itself is not known but has a certain known property, e.g., it is periodic with a known period. Kao, C. K., A. Sinha, and A. K. Mahalanabis. "A Digital Algorithm for Near-Minimum-Time Control of Robot Manipulators." Journal of Dynamic Systems, Measurement, and Control 109, no. 4 (1987): 320–27. http://dx.doi.org/10.1115/1.3143861.

Full text
Abstract:
A digital state feedback control algorithm has been developed to obtain the near-minimum-time trajectory for the end-effector of a robot manipulator. In this algorithm, the poles of the linearized closed loop system are judiciously placed in the Z-plane to permit near-minimum-time response without violating the constraints on the actuator torques. The validity of this algorithm has been established using numerical simulations. A three-link manipulator is chosen for this purpose and the results are discussed for three different combinations of initial and final states.

Kogler, Helmut, Rudolf Scheidl, and Bernd Hans Schmidt. "Analysis of Wave Propagation Effects in Transmission Lines due to Digital Valve Switching." In ASME/BATH 2015 Symposium on Fluid Power and Motion Control. American Society of Mechanical Engineers, 2015. http://dx.doi.org/10.1115/fpmc2015-9607.

Full text
Abstract:
In digital hydraulic systems, switching valves have opening and closing times in the range of a few milliseconds. Due to this fast switching, high bandwidth pressure pulsation is excited, which is the stimulus for airborne noise up to some kilohertz. Since the human ear is very sensitive to audible noise in this frequency range, an analysis of the influence of the valve’s opening curve on the pressure surge in the pipe system is intended.
